MUFG Investor Services bolsters private equity team
19 March 2019 London
Reporter: Jenna Lomax

Image: Shutterstock
MUFG Investor Services, the global asset servicing arm of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group, has appointed Andrew Stewart as executive director of private equity and real asset sales for Europe, Middle East and Africa (EMEA).

Stewart’s started on 4 March and reports to Oliver Scully, head of EMEA sales.

In his new role, he is responsible for driving the sales and growth of MUFG Investor Services’ asset servicing solutions to investors and managers across the private equity and real asset sectors in EMEA.

He also promotes the uptake and usage of MUFG Investor Services’ suite of products including fund administration, outsourcing, custody, depositary, trustee, fund of fund financing, alongside other banking and treasury solutions.

Stewart has almost 30 years of experience in the financial services industry across Europe, North America and Asia.

Prior to MUFG Investor Services, Stewart served at Citco as executive vice president, responsible for sales to private equity and real estate funds and investors in Europe.

Stewart’s appointment follows other recent senior private equity and real asset hires at MUFG Investor Services, including the appointment of Bruno Bagnols as managing director and head of private equity and real assets of Mitsubishi UFJ Investor Services and Banking Luxembourg S.A. earlier this month.
